A1: Candidates need to provide the following files:
Valid ID (passport or nationwide ID card)Medical certificate confirming physical fitness to driveProof of completed driving course (if appropriate)Q2: What is the minimum age to use for a driving license in Poland?
A2: The minimum age to look for a category B driving license (for automobile) is 18 years.
Q3: How much does it cost to take the driving license test in Poland?
A3: The expenses can vary however usually include:
Driving course fees: PLN 1,800 to PLN 3,000Theoretical test charge: PLN 30Dry run charge: PLN 140Q4: How many attempts are allowed to pass the driving test?
A4: Candidates can take the theoretical or useful test numerous times; however, they should pay the exam charge for each effort.
Q5: How long is a Polish driving license valid?
A5: A Polish driving license is usually legitimate for 15 years. After this period, it needs to be restored; this procedure requires a brand-new medical exam.
